    Position Overview and Responsibilities:

    This is an administrative position to provide high-level operational and administrative support to the staff in the Marine Mammal program.

     

    The primary duties of this position will involve overseeing staff purchasing processes, including creating, processing, and tracking purchasing requisitions, contract management, and invoices as well as assisting staff with credit card payments. Additional duties will include managing section resources such as cell phones, property, and monthly fuel log submissions and will also serve as the coordinator for our annual open house “MarineQuest” event. Performs other duties as assigned.

    VETERANS’ PREFERENCE. Pursuant to Chapter 295, Florida Statutes, candidates eligible for Veterans’ Preference will receive preference in employment for Career Service vacancies and are encouraged to apply. Certain service members may be eligible to receive waivers for postsecondary educational requirements. Candidates claiming Veterans’ Preference must attach supporting documentation with each submission that includes character of service (for example, DD Form 214 Member Copy #4) along with any other documentation as required by Rule 55A-7, Florida Administrative Code. Veterans’ Preference documentation requirements are available by clickinghere (http://www.dms.myflorida.com/content/download/97612/566545) . All documentation is due by the close of the vacancy announcement.
